Is there a HORN fuse/relay?
I recently removed my 930S steering wheel and had a bear of a time replacing it when I inadvertantly completely disassembled the horn plates, etc...
Now, it is back together, but my horn won't honk. Even when I touch the two spades together - nothing. A quick look at the fuse block doesn't reveal a horn fuse. Is there a relay I am missing (not seeing)? |
OK, I found the relay. I swapped it with the FOG LAMP relay (appears to be the same) and still no horn.
Ideas? |
Third update...
It is a contact issue with the horn installation. The horn honks when I push in the top of the steering wheel. Awrg. Now, the steering wheel is coming off.... |
It works now.
The copper contact wasn't making contact with the copper ring on the back of the steering wheel. I cleaned it, and gently bent some more "spring" into it. Reassembled and everything works. Thanks for listening everyone! |
